The Club, Barbados Resort & Spa vs Coral Reef Club
Both properties are endorsed by those who travel for a living. On balance, Coral Reef Club is preferred by most professionals compared to The Club, Barbados Resort & Spa. Coral Reef Club is ranked #2 in Barbados with endorsements from 10 reviewers such as Jetsetter, Star Service and Frommer's.
